The downtown Flint festivities are being hosted by The Flint Journal/MLive Media Group along with The Spencer Agency, Buckham Gallery, Genesee Regional Chamber of Commerce and the Crim Fitness Foundation.

The official walk starts at noon at The Journal's new offices, 540 S. Saginaw St. in the Rowe Building, and winds through the University of Michigan-Flint and Cultural Center campuses. Walkers will get free gifts along the way.

The event is free and open to the public.
